I removed the AM BC filter on KA1GJU Super Station #2
I happened to be in the repeater shed and noticed a user on the new SDR-IP was down in the LW band. The AM BC filter was primarily for the RSP1A due to it's poor front end hearing/seeing AM signals all the way up into 40m. So... enjoy AM BC now on Super Station #2! Re: 3.3 build 2870 - Waterfall "noise" while adjusting the brightness/contrast
I think you might me exceeding the limits of your computer. BC-FM uses more CPU resources vs SSB, from my humble observations. Re: HF Noise Jump - Wellgood Loop / RX-888 MKII
I have an active loop that I use for DF'ing noises (RFI). I plot the nulls on a paper map (google map in satellite map mode zoomed in to the neighborhood) or use APRS.fi and use the plotter tool zoomed in on a satellite map thats zoomed in.
